Do you like dragons? Dig ages? Love faces? Adore books? OH FOR GOD’S SAKE WE’VE GOT A MOTHERSHITTER OF A TREAT! Electronic Arts is bringing Dragon Age Legends to Facebook, which is sure to make fans vomit blood out of their armpits with delight.Â
“Dragon Age Legends blends accessible and engaging tactical combat with compelling co-operative gameplay perfectly suited for social networks, making for a unique offering on the platform,” says the EA spiel. Launching in February 2011, Dragon Age Legends will also give gamers the chance to earn exclusive unlocks for Dragon Age II, one of the most highly anticipated video games of 2011.”
You’ll need one of those stupid EA accounts for the unlocks, but it looks like it’ll be a nice timewaster for those who just can’t get enough Dragon Age and want to earn some extra goodies while they feed their addiction. Seems this whole EA/Facebook thing is going to turn out well for the publisher.Â
